The average weekly salary for a Cognitive Scientist in Australia is approximately $1,883. Increase your earning capacity by obtaining supporting qualifications in psychology, information technology, data analytics, and neuroscience. You could also join the Australasian Cognitive Neuroscience Society (ACNS).

There are no clear employment figures for Cognitive Scientists currently working in Australia. They can work in academia, health and medicine, artificial intelligence, robotics, and human-computer interfaces.

To become a Cognitive Scientist in Australia you will need post-graduate qualifications including a PhD. Get started with an undergraduate Bachelor of Cognitive and Brain Sciences, Bachelor of Science (Neuroscience), Bachelor of Psychology (Cognitive Neuroscience), or (double-degree) Bachelor of Cognitive and Brain Sciences/Bachelor of Information Technology. You’ll then need to pursue a Master of Research (Medicine, Health and Human Sciences), Master of Neuroscience (Advanced), or Master of Brain and Mind Sciences.
